Liquid Ethane Mother and Child Tank
The liquid ethane mother and child tank refers to a storage tank composed of multiple child tanks containing LNG arranged in parallel and placed within a mother tank filled with insulating material. It is typically constructed to meet large volume and pressurized storage requirements, and is commonly used in medium to large-scale LNG vaporization stations (1000m³ to 10000m³ storage capacity).

Product Structure
The LNG mother and child tank consists of multiple child tanks, a mother tank, and corresponding process pipelines, valves, instruments, etc.
Child Tank: Serving as the main container for low-temperature media, it is made of austenitic stainless steel S30408 material; the child tank has a vertical cylindrical leg structure, and depending on the volume, 4, 7, or 10 child tanks are interconnected through pipelines to connect all or grouped gas and liquid phases.
Mother Tank: Serving as the protective shell of the insulation system, it is usually made of Q345R/16MnDR material. The mother tank accommodates all child tanks and uses powder accumulation insulation to maintain cold storage, ensuring minimal vaporization of the stored medium.

Main Advantages
The equipment has a large individual storage capacity, occupies less space, requires less investment, and is easy to operate compared to vacuum tanks of the same volume.
The equipment maintains operating pressure through a self-pressurizer, eliminating the need for booster pumps, BOG compressors, and other equipment, resulting in low operating costs and easy maintenance.
